solve
(4/x)-(2/5)=(6/x)

(4/x) - (2/5) = (6/x)

Move the variables to one side:

-(2/5) = (6/x) - (4/x)

Then simplify:

-(2/5) = (2/x)

-(2/5)x = 2

x = -5

You can check by substituting the solution back in, replacing the variable.
